SummaryGroups can be formed as a fixed or static set or as a varying or dynamic set. Previously, no researcher considered groups, other than the two configurations. Yet, a new method is the formation of groups and the signatures, based on demand approach, which non trivializes the issue. By considering groups as virtual, issues of scalability, revocation rights of members, memory area for storage of private key for each member, etc, are addressed. The dynamic characteristics of private key, public key, partial signatures of individual members, as well as the group as an entity are factors. The generation of signatures by a group member is with its private key and the groups partial signature. This arrangement facilitates many advantages such as scalability, revocation, tracing, man‐ in‐the‐middle attacks, space requirements, and multiple keys of the group members. Even so, the procedure is adaptable for cloud computing, group communication as in banks to access group accounts with group signatures, group mobile communication, etc. This framework automates the banking system completely.
